Responsibilities
The work of a Summer Associate can be either qualitative or quantitative in nature, and projects range from industry and subject matter research to data collection to the preparation of statistical, financial, and other forms of analysis. Summer Associates should be able to assemble compelling evidence from data and research that supports our expert opinions.
- Develop and maintain electronic databases, spreadsheets and other files as dictated by project needs.
- Use programming, model building, and regression analysis skills in statistical analysis programs (such as Stata, R, or Python) and combined with their economic intuition to produce analysis for a variety of cases and/or projects across industries.
- Perform detailed research and analysis, then put the results into action (e.g., gather, review, and summarize literature and data from the public domain, specialized industry resources, or client, public and commercial databases).
- Produce analysis for a variety of cases and/or projects across industry.
- Interact with senior staff, leadership, and clients to communicate economic concepts in an understandable manner.
- Demonstrate creativity and efficient use of relevant software tools, analytical methods, and computer models to develop solutions.
- Apply critical thinking skills in quantitative and qualitative analysis.
- Audit own work product and work product of others to assure quality.
- Participate in a team environment and work hard to meet client deadlines and quality expectations.
- Keep abreast of relevant policies with state regulating bodies on an ongoing basis.
